Mesoscopic superconductors under irradiation: Microwave spectroscopy of Andreev states

N. I. Lundin, L. Y. Gorelik, R. I. Shekhter, V. S. Shumeiko, M. Jonson

cond-mat.supr-conarXiv:cond-mat/9811200

Abstract

We show that irradiation of a voltage-biased superconducting quantum point contact at frequencies of the order of the gap energy can remove the suppression of subgap dc transport through Andreev levels. Quantum interference among resonant scattering events involving photon absorption is furthermore shown to make microwave spectroscopy of the Andreev levels feasible. We also discuss how the same interference effect can be applied for detecting weak electromagnetic signals up to the gap frequency, and how it is affected by dephasing and relaxation.
